Paris Agreement

/ˈpær.ɪs əˈgriː.mənt/proper noun
ELI5 mode

The Paris Agreement is a landmark international treaty adopted in 2015 that commits nearly every country to addressing climate change by limiting global temperature rise. It emphasizes collective action through nationally determined contributions, while adapting to the impacts of a warming planet and providing financial support to developing nations. In modern contexts, it's seen as a flexible framework that evolves with scientific advancements and geopolitical shifts.
